Understanding the Dutch Horse Racing Landscape

Before diving into Bingoal, it’s essential to grasp the broader context. The Dutch horse racing scene, while not as prominent as in the UK or Ireland, has a dedicated following. Races are held at various tracks, and the interest is fueled by a combination of tradition, the thrill of the sport, and the potential for a win. The legal framework for online gambling in the Netherlands, regulated by the Kansspelautoriteit (KSA), is crucial. Operators must obtain a license to legally offer their services, and compliance with KSA regulations is paramount. This includes responsible gambling measures, player protection, and fair play. The KSA’s strict enforcement significantly impacts how operators like Bingoal can operate and market their horse racing products. The Dutch market’s unique characteristics, including cultural preferences and regulatory requirements, shape the strategies operators employ to attract and retain players.
